Coldplay, Taylor Swift, Beyoncé and more shows for you to watch online

Streaming platforms have been increasingly innovating in their catalog and are going far beyond just series and movies, offering the public several options of shows to watch online🇧🇷

Pop star Taylor Swift, current generation darling Billie Eilish and international music queen Beyoncé are some of the artists who have shows available for streaming. Check out the top 10 options below!

10. Ariana Grande

The pop princess toured the world with high-quality shows on the Sweetener World Tour and presented fans with a complete presentation of the moment in a movie available on Netflix.

In addition to the show, the documentary features behind-the-scenes footage of the tour and never-before-seen footage of the singer.

9. Coldplay

One of the bands with the most acclaimed shows of all time, Coldplay presented fans with the film Head Full Of Dreams in 2018.

It tells the rise of members Chris Martin, Guy Berryman, Phil Harvey, Jonny Buckland and Will Champion on this tour and is available to stream on Amazon Prime Video.

8. Adele

the documentary Adele: One Night Only marked the return of one of the greatest singers to the music industry. Adele shared not only a full concert with songs from the 30th album, but also an exclusive interview with Oprah.

The show is available for streaming on Globoplay and fans can find the singer’s hits together with the most recent hits in the film.

7. Beyonce

Global industry darling Beyoncé also has a show available for streaming, the homecoming🇧🇷 It follows the singer’s show at Coachella 2018, in which she was the headliner.

The two-hour-plus documentary won the Grammy for Best Musical Film and is available for fans to enjoy on Netflix.

6. Sandy and Junior

Sandy and Júnior returned to the stage in 2019 to celebrate 30 years of career, as a way to give gifts to fans. Traveling through the main Brazilian cities, Nossa História is available for streaming on Globoplay.

The documentary not only presents one of the concerts of the tour, but also the backstage of this remarkable moment.

5. Emicida

The album AmarElo became one of the biggest milestones in Brazilian music and the icon Emicida launched the AmarElo: Concert Film on the Netflix platform to present fans with one of the shows, held at Theatro Municipal de São Paulo.

The film features national music stars, such as Pabllo Vittar and Majur, and represents the full strength of the rap singer.

4. Billie Eilish

After the success of their second studio album, Happier Than EverBillie Eilish took advantage of her fame to share some of her show routines with fans in a documentary available on Disney+.

O Happier Than Ever: A Love Letter to Los Angeles is over 1 hour long and takes you into the universe of this introspective and emotional album.

3. Shawn Mendes

Available for streaming on Netflix, the show Shawn Mendes: The Tour accompanies the Canadian star in a show held in his hometown of Toronto. The documentary features the participation of the star Camila Cabello, the singer’s girlfriend at the time.

It reinforces Shawn’s position as a world music icon and is a great choice for fans to rejoin the singer at one of his shows.

2. Madonna

Consecrated as the queen of pop, Madonna shared one of the most remarkable shows of recent years, the madam x, in a documentary available on Paramount+. It transcends themes such as political repression and freedom of expression.

The singer, known for her bubblegum hits, presented her most intimate and introspective face in this film.

1. Taylor Swift

Taylor Swift has become one of the biggest singers in the music industry and not only has one show available for streaming, but two full shows for fans to enjoy.

THE Reputation Stadium Tourfrom 2018, is available in the Netflix catalog, while the Folklore: The Long Pond Studio Sessions is the singer’s special, available on Disney+.
